You can jump into it directly at <a href=\"https:\/\/www.hotbot.com\/c\/hotbot-chat\">hotbot.com\/c\/hotbot-chat<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>A word of warning about AI subject lines in general: they tend toward the middle. The folks at Magnet Monster, who <a href=\"https:\/\/www.magnetmonster.com\/blog\/11-point-checklist-leveraging-klaviyos-ai-functions-for-enhanced-email-marketing\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">audited 100+ Klaviyo accounts<\/a>, put it well \u2014 AI subject lines are &#8220;rarely terrible but rarely memorable.&#8221; So treat the eight options as a starting point. Pick two, rewrite them in your own voice, and A\/B test. Don&#8217;t ship them raw.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Step 3: Repurpose One Email Into Many<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>You wrote a good campaign. Follow your own company&#8217;s data-handling rules first.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Common Issues<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>The draft sounds generic.<\/strong> You probably didn&#8217;t give it enough brand voice or a specific enough segment. Add example emails and tighten the audience.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Subject lines feel samey.<\/strong> Ask for more range explicitly: &#8220;give me 4 curiosity-driven, 4 benefit-driven, all under 40 characters.&#8221; Then edit.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>The recap misses context.<\/strong> Make sure you&#8217;re on Chat Pro for analysis tasks, and tell it what &#8220;good&#8221; looks like for you \u2014 your benchmarks, not generic ones.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>I don&#8217;t see the connector.<\/strong> Connectors are members-only.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.hotbot.com\/login\">Sign in or subscribe<\/a> first.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">What&#8217;s Next<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Once this loop feels natural, tighten it.
